IN COMMITTEE ON FINANCE. - VOTE 44—HOSPITALS AND CHARITIES

I move:—

Go ndeontar suim ná raghaidh thar £1,728 chun slánuithe na suime is gá chun íoctha an Mhuirir a thiocfidh chun bheith iníoctha i rith na bliana dar críoch an 31adh lá dé Mhárta, 1927, chun éilithe mar gheall ar Capidéil agus Otharlanna agus Liúntaisí áirithe Ilghnéitheacha Déirciúla agus eile, maraon le hIldeontaisí i gCabhair.

That a sum not exceeding £1,728 be granted to complete the sum necessary to defray the Charge which will come in course of payment during the year ending on the 31st day of March, 1927, for Charges connected with Hospitals and Infirmaries, and certain Miscellaneous Charitable and other Allowances, including sundry Grants-in-Aid.

The principal charges dealt with in this Vote are statutory, and for a very long period they have not been either increased or decreased. I explained them fully last year and the year previous, and I do not think they call for any statement from me now.

Vote 44 put and agreed to.
